Aerial firing claims 4 lives separately
By MANSOOR KHAN July 28, 2008 The last weekend claimed the life of an old man and wounded a little girl in two separate incidents. Sixty-year-old Dilbar Khan received bullet wounds due to the firing by some youths in the wedding ceremony of his neighbour in the jurisdiction of Mominabad police station. He was immediately taken to Abbasi Shaheed Hospital where he died on Sunday
Similarly, nine-year-old Saba, daughter of Ejazuddin, received bullet injuries when she was sleeping on the roof of her house at Korangi No 5 on Saturday. She received bullet wounds on her head and was admitted to Jinnah Medical Centre where doctors declared her condition critical. The incident took place when participants of two wedding ceremonies being held near her house resorted to aerial firing.
